Question 1: Which EEG frequency band is most prominently associated with active cognitive processing and problem-solving?
- Delta (0.5–4 Hz)
- Theta (4–8 Hz)
- Alpha (8–13 Hz)
- Beta (13–30 Hz) (Correct answer)
Correct answer: Beta (13–30 Hz)
Beta activity predominates during active mental engagement, concentration, and problem-solving tasks.
Question 2: A 60-Hz artifact appearing on EEG channels is most likely caused by:
- Patient movement
- Electrode impedance mismatch
- AC electrical interference (Correct answer)
- Muscle artifact from the frontalis
Correct answer: AC electrical interference
60-Hz artifact results from alternating current (AC) electrical interference from nearby equipment or poor grounding.
Question 3: During N3 sleep, the EEG is characterized by:
- Sleep spindles and K-complexes
- Low-voltage mixed-frequency activity
- High-amplitude slow waves occupying ≥20% of the epoch (Correct answer)
- Sawtooth waves and REMs
Correct answer: High-amplitude slow waves occupying ≥20% of the epoch
N3 is defined by slow-wave activity (0.5–2 Hz, ≥75 µV) comprising at least 20% of the 30-second epoch.
Question 4: Vertex sharp waves (V waves) in a sleep study are most characteristic of which sleep stage?
- REM sleep
- N1 sleep (Correct answer)
- N2 sleep
- N3 sleep
Correct answer: N1 sleep
Vertex sharp waves are electropositive transients maximal at the vertex and are a hallmark of N1 sleep.
Question 5: A HEOG (horizontal electro-oculogram) montage detects eye movements by placing electrodes:
- Above and below each eye
- At the outer canthi of each eye (Correct answer)
- At the inner canthi of each eye
- At the supraorbital ridge bilaterally
Correct answer: At the outer canthi of each eye
HEOG electrodes are placed at the outer canthi (lateral edges) of each eye to detect lateral eye movements.

Question 7: In referential (monopolar) EEG recording, the reference electrode should ideally be placed at a site that is:
- Maximally active electrically
- Electrically neutral or minimally active (Correct answer)
- Directly over the frontal lobe
- On the same side as the active electrode
Correct answer: Electrically neutral or minimally active
A reference electrode should be electrically neutral to accurately reflect the potential of the active electrode without introducing its own signal.
